"Mirror Auto Tilt automatically tilts mirrors downward when backing up. To turn this feature on or off, touch Controls > Mirrors > Mirror Auto Tilt. To adjust the auto-tilt position, touch Adjust Tilted Position and make mirror adjustments as needed. After adjusting the tilted position and touching Save, mirrors will automatically tilt to the configured position whenever you shift into Reverse. When you shift out of Reverse, mirrors tilt back to their normal (upward) position."

I'm not talking about when you reverse, it changes positions when I set it to park.
Ok, I looked again and found it. Ensure the selected profile is "Easy Entry", make your mirrors adjustments, then also make steering wheel adjustments. The save option appears when you are adjusting the steering wheel.

Tesla likely forgot to include 'save' in the mirror adjustment UI.
